A coveted accomplishment that Pokemon fans strive for is obtaining a shiny version of their favorite capturable Pokemon. These are incredibly rare Pokemon variants that can be caught or found by players in the mainline games. Players of Pokemon Sword and Shield have various methods of increasing their chances of encountering a Shiny Pokemon such as obtaining the Shiny Charm item. This item dramatically increases the odds of getting the elusive Shinies, along with other methods like the "Masuda Method" when breeding Pokemon. One player of Pokemon Sword and Shield set out to reclaim a shiny Pokemon that they had once caught, but lost in a trade.

According to user UnovaKid24, they captured their first ever shiny mon in Pokemon White, but traded it away. The Pokemon they traded was a male Unfezant, the final evolved stage of Pidove, the "Tiny Pidgeon" Pokemon. In exchange, they received a Rapidash, a fire-type Pokemon that was also shiny and several levels higher than the Unfezant they were offering, much to the bafflement of the user. While they have come to regret the decision in recent years, they aimed to rectify the situation in Sword and Shield.

The user posted to the Pokemon Sword and Shield subreddit that their attempt to get the same shiny Pokemon had been met with success. Thanks to their dedication, the Shiny Pokemon was able to be hatched within 50 eggs. This is due to the odds of hatching Shinies in Sword and Shield being adjusted, with the chance of coming across this shiny within the estimated range.

UnovaKid24 was extremely happy to be reunited with the shiny Unfezant after a decade regret from trading their original.
